Trend of Annual Unemployment Rate of New Caledonia

Updated on May 15, 2026.

According to recent data from the World Bank, the total unemployment rate of New Caledonia was 11.17% in 2026, a difference of +0.18 points compared to 2025; and the total labor force of New Caledonia in 2026 was 131,488. The most recent figures on male and female unemployment rates were 10.39% and 12.08% respectively in 2026.

The World Bank defines unemployment rate as "the share of the labor force that is without work but available for and seeking employment".

Year Total Unempl.(%) Male Unempl.(%) Female Unempl.(%)
1991 18.12 15.36 21.47
1992 18.61 15.78 22.05
1993 18.76 15.92 22.23
1994 18.88 16.02 22.37
1995 18.63 15.8 22.07
1996 18.64 15.81 22.08
1997 18.38 15.6 21.76
1998 18.52 15.74 21.91
1999 18.2 15.49 21.51
2000 17.91 15.24 21.13
2001 17.39 14.82 20.5
2002 17.05 14.53 20.07
2003 16.67 14.22 19.59
2004 16.31 13.92 19.14
2005 15.78 13.48 18.49
2006 15.26 13.05 17.85
2007 14.75 12.64 17.24
2008 14.36 12.32 16.76
2009 13.97 12.01 16.29
2010 14 12.26 16.03
2011 13.99 12.48 15.74
2012 14.12 12.83 15.61
2013 14.39 13.31 15.64
2014 14.59 13.73 15.59
2015 13.62 12.53 14.88
2016 12.68 11.35 14.2
2017 11.68 10.12 13.45
2018 11.7 11.61 11.81
2019 10.88 10.27 11.57
2020 13.56 14.12 12.93
2021 11.57 11.35 11.82
2022 10.71 10.49 10.97
2023 10.92 10.31 11.62
2024 10.99 10.38 11.7
2025 11.17 10.39 12.08
